2011-11-03 60 views

回答

4

對於這個特殊的問題:

set foo "t:" 
pack [label .l -textvar foo] 
bind . <Key-plus> {append foo "+"} 
bind . <Key-KP_Add> {append foo "(+)"} 
bind . <Key-minus> {append foo "-"} 
bind . <Key-KP_Subtract> {append foo "(-)"} 

但一般而言,您可以通過運行「xev的」,並按下該鍵查找鍵名。

+4

另外,開始希望,運行'綁定。 {puts%K}',然後在希望窗口中按下必要的鍵 - 它將在控制檯上打印相應的「keysyms」。與僅在X Window中找到的'xev'相比,這是跨平臺的。 – kostix